Summary: Three years after the battle at Hogwarts and the War is still going on. Voldemort is rising in power and the Order is struggling to stay afloat. Despite some members' insistence on not using dark magic and fighting fair, Kingsley Shacklebot employs one Death Eater spy and an exceptional witch to act as the Order's secret weapon.


It was dead silent. There wasn't even a clock on the wall to interrupt the silence with its ticking as Hermione glared across the room at Malfoy. When Kingsley had told her that Snape had recruited another Death Eater spy months ago, she never would have thought it would be Draco Malfoy. She definitely hadn't expected it to be him who Kingsley anticipated her working with to win the War.

"I see you both agree," Kingsley said calmly, clasping his hands in front of him.

Around them, the safe house was ruined. The walls were crumbling and some of the furniture was still on fire from the close range spell Hermione had shot at Malfoy's head. To say the first meeting had gone poorly would be an understatement. Even Kingsley's robes had been singed and torn.

"We'll take out each other before we take out the Dark Lord," Malfoy said coldly, glaring at Hermione just as fiercely. His arms were crossed in front of him, but his wand was still pointed in her direction.

"I'm sure you'll figure something out," Kingsley replied. He gave Hermione a pointed look and she forced herself to uncross her arms. She did not stop glaring. "Perfect. I expect Hermione can inform you of your first mission as I have a meeting to attend. Try not to destroy the safe house even further."

With a loud crack, Kingsley apparated away and Hermione and Malfoy were left to scowl at each other.

"I agreed to kill for the Order, not work with you," Malfoy sneered, stuffing his wand in a holster on his arm. Hermione kept hers out.

"You should have asked more questions then," Hermione snapped in reply. Malfoy glared at her but Hermione was undeterred. The room was silent for several tense minutes before Hermione remembered Kingsley had already given them their first mission. Malfoy had been the one to report it, but Kingsley had assigned it to them after hearing just how badly injured most of the Order was after their last skirmish. "Edinburgh, you said?"

"Yeah," Malfoy said with a nod. "He's really just leaving us to do this on our own?"

Hermione rolled her eyes. Kingsley didn't have much left to hope for and after the brutal fight they'd had in the safe house, Hermione wasn't all that worried about the odds.

"As long as you can manage to not have a predictable attack pattern, we should be fine," Hermione taunted. Malfoy flicked his wrist at her but she brushed aside the small knives before they were even within reach.

"At least I can fight with both hands," Malfoy bit back.

Hermione's face was starting to hurt from glaring so much, but before she could snap back, Malfoy had grabbed her arm and they were apparating to Edinburgh.

* * * * *

Kingsley seemed to think that by forcing Hermione to meet up with Malfoy almost every day, that maybe they would start to get along better. Unfortunately for him, most of their meetings consisted of dueling each other and critiquing the other's movement or lack thereof. There was never any small talk and usually the last to arrive was the first to throw a spell, but Kingsley always asked how the meeting went. Even though Hermione's answer never changed, he seemed pleased.

"I suspect you've both made great progress in dueling," Kingsley said.

Hermione was quickly growing more and more irritated with Kingsley.

"Now, Severus informed me there's an informal Death Eater meeting tonight. Only three, but hitting them unexpectedly can throw off an entire attack. I suspect you and Draco can handle it."

"I can handle it without him," Hermione argued. Why Kingsley thought she needed Malfoy around to to take of three Death Eaters was beyond her.

"Nevertheless, he's been summoned and should be at the safe house to meet you in five minutes," he answered, slipping her a piece of paper with a location written on it.

Hermione frowned but didn't say anything else before apparating away. The sooner she got to the safe house to meet Malfoy, the sooner she could take out her frustrations on some Death Eaters.

Unfortunately, Malfoy wasn't already at the safe house when she arrived. Rather than wait idly, she kept an eye out for him so she wouldn't be surprised by an attack. The last thing she expected was for Malfoy to appear across the room in front of her with a large gash across his face that was clearly fresh.

"What the hell happened to you?" she snapped, her fingers twitching around her wand. Despite having no obligation to, she was already thinking of multiple spells to keep his forehead and cheek from scarring and speed up the healing process.

"Fuck off," Malfoy snapped back. Hermione glared at him and took two steps forward. Malfoy didn't move, but he did eye her warily. "You can't heal it if that's what you're thinking."

"I know ways to get around those spells," Hermione replied. She pointed her wand at his face but Malfoy didn't flinch. Wordlessly, she cast a charm to speed up whatever healing process he was going through. Malfoy grimaced but said nothing. She grunted out another spell to prevent it from scarring then stepped back. "Now that you're not bleeding all over, Kingsley called because he got word there's a small meeting we're supposed to disrupt."

Malfoy frowned.

"Where?" he asked. Hermione pulled on the paper and handed it to him. As soon as he read it, the paper lit up in flames and disappeared. "Fine. Let's go."

Together, they apparated to a couple of kilometers south of where the meeting actually was and began the long walk through the forest. As they neared a clearing, they found not three, but a dozen Death Eaters standing in a group around a fire. Before they were noticed, Malfoy grabbed Hermione and shoved her further back, stepping back silently so they were not spotted.

"When has a dozen ever been small?" he breathed, glaring at her from under his hood.

"Kingsley said three!" she hissed back. They dropped soundlessly as a loud laugh came from the clearing. Now hidden by the short bushes, Hermione looked up at Malfoy. "Can you identify them?"

Malfoy poked his head above the bushes and looked at the group for several minutes. When he dropped back down, he shook his head.

"I can't hear them from here and they're not moving," he told her quietly. Hermione frowned. It was unlikely they were all high ranking, but even Death Eaters that were only recently recruited were still skilled duelists.

"First one to seven kills wins," Hermione whispered. She sat up just enough to see over the bushes and shot two killing curses before the first surprised shout came from the clearing.

Malfoy threw up a shield just in time for a series of killing curses and crucios to come flying at them, quietly cursing Hermione for taking the first shot. She just grinned and leaned around the shield to shoot another curse at the group. The shield faltered and with a nod, both Hermione and Malfoy dove to opposite sides and took cover in the bushes.

While the Death Eaters continued to fire curses at where they'd previously been, Hermione silently apparated to the other side of the clearing. Even before being given stealth missions by Kingsley, Hermione had always been proud to have discovered a way to apparate silently. She'd shown Harry and a few other Order members, but clearly she still needed to show Malfoy if the loud crack she'd heard when they first arrived was anything to go by.

As the Death Eaters' attack on their now-empty hiding spot slowed down, Hermione raised her wand and leveled it to rest perfectly on the centermost Death Eater. Before they could disperse to look for their bodies, Hermione shot her curse the same time Malfoy sent a volley of killing curses.

Hermione dropped to the ground to avoid a rouge killing curse and peered over the grass to see what her spell had done to the group. She'd never tried it outside of her lab so there was a chance it wouldn't actually work, but as three more Death Eaters fell dead and two screamed in pain, she grinned.

As the last Death Eater fell by Malfoy's wand, Hermione stepped out of the shadows and walked into the clearing to make sure all the Death Eaters were dead. She peered over their bodies, kicking them with her steel toed boot just to be certain. She looked down at one of the Death Eaters, staring at the hole in his chest her curse had created and kicked off his mask. An unfamiliar face stared back up at her and she moved on, kicking off the rest of the masks.

"What was that spell you just used?" Malfoy asked, sliding out of the bushes and staring out across the bodies. His face was still covered by his hood, but Hermione pulled hers off and smoothed her hair.

"You'd have never come across it," she replied, kicking another mask off. "I created it. It targets those within two meters of where it hits and tears through muscle until they die. The Order found it too vicious." Hermione glanced up at him to see a small smirk spread across his lips. Her foot hovered near the last masked Death Eater as she looked at Malfoy and said, "I have a whole arsenal of spells worse than—"

"Crucio!"

Blinding pain hit her chin from below as the Death Eater she'd thought was dead raised his wand at her. She didn't cry out as the pain washed over her in waves, biting her cheek to keep from screaming and giving away their location. The pain didn't last long as the man who had cast it was weak, but it was enough to have Hermione panting when it finally disappeared. When she could see straight again, Malfoy was standing over the Death Eater with his wand pointed at him.

She brushed her hair from her face, grimacing at the sweat that had formed on her forehead from the pain, then twisted around to make sure none of the other Death Eaters were faking their death. Unfortunately for them, there seemed to be new holes in their chests that hadn't been there before she'd been attacked.

"They're all dead now," Malfoy muttered, stepping away from the last Death Eater. He reached down and pulled her to her feet. Her body ached and she swayed, but Malfoy kept his arm under her shoulders to keep her upright. "Can you apparate?"

"Of course," Hermione scoffed.

Malfoy released her and she swayed. She scowled when he smirked and kept his hold on her.

"Fine. Just take me to the safe house and I can manage from there."

Malfoy nodded and they both apparated away with a loud crack.

* * * * *

Hermione was getting frustrated. Every week, Kingsley would call meetings for the core Order members to discuss new attack methods and every week, the Order would refuse to start casting more fatal spells. Some of them did when necessary, but overall, Harry discouraged the use of dark magic. Despite how often Hermione told him she could craft fatal spells that weren't connected to the dark arts, Harry refused to even hear her ideas. Today was no different even though Ginny was in the hospital ward and Harry was badly wounded.

"The Death Eaters aren't as popular anymore," Harry insisted, making Hermione scowl at the table. "Their numbers are dropping and they aren't attacking as often anymore. What we're doing is working."

"But if we used other spells, the War could be over quicker," Hermione argued. Kingsley gave her a look and she fumed as he agreed with Harry.

For the remainder of the meeting, Hermione tuned out everyone who spoke and tried not to be too upset with the way the Order was treating the War. As soon as they were all dismissed, she hurried down to the hospital ward to help Madam Pomfrey with anything she could just to distract herself. She was in the middle of treating a minor burn on George's arm when Kingsley's patronus summoned her to his office. She finished George's burn, sent him on his way, then slipped away to Kingsley's office.

"There's word the Death Eaters are going south to set up anti-apparation lines," Kingsley said. He handed her a sealed envelope and she stuffed it in her pocket. "Draco will arrive at the safe house as soon as he can, but I want you to wait there so you can leave at the earliest moment."

"Calling him away so often is getting suspicious," Hermione said with a frown. Kingsley had been sending them out at least once a week and Malfoy had mentioned last week his father had said something about his regular disappearances. "He can't always come with me if he's expected to keep his cover in tact."

"Tell him if he wants to continue his alliance with the Order, he'll figure out a way to maintain cover and come when needed," Kingsley said. He nodded at her then turned around and returned to his desk. With a frown, Hermione apparated out of his office and to the safe house to await Malfoy.

They'd already had several missions together and most of them hadn't needed the both of them. After their last mission that could have easily been completed by Hermione alone, Malfoy had voiced his concern about his cover amongst the Death Eaters. She'd hoped Kingsley would care more for Malfoy's wellbeing seeing as he was an important contact in Voldemort's ranks, but since he hadn't, she would now have to figure out a way to do so herself.

Just as she'd figured out a way to protect Malfoy's cover and still contact him for important meetings, Malfoy apparated right in front of her. She jumped in surprise before glaring at him. Clearly teaching him how to apparate silently hadn't been well thought out.

"What's that?" he asked, pulling one of her transfigured charms out of her hands. She let him look it over before taking it back and stringing it through an unbreakable chain.

"That is for you," she answered, handing him the necklace that now had the skull charm attached. Malfoy frowned at it but slipped it over his head while she clasped the other one around her neck. "Kingsley doesn't care about your cover," she said bluntly. He blinked in surprise, but she continued, "I charmed this to alert you to any missions that actually need the two of us. If the necklace doesn't heat up, you aren't necessary for the mission, so don't come. Kingsley will never know."

"What happens if you overestimate?" Malfoy asked, snatching the torn envelope from the counter top near her. He skimmed over the mission while Hermione rolled her eyes.

"I'll activate the charm twice if that happens," she answered. He nodded and tossed the mission envelope aside.

"One alert means come," he repeated, holding out his arm for her to grab onto. "Two alerts means you're dying and I should come immediately to witness the spectacle."

"Yes," Hermione drawled sarcastically, taking hold of his arm tightly. "Precisely that," she said, before the feeling of apparation drowned out her words and they were disappearing.

* * * * *

"Fuck. Fuck, fuck, fuck."

He'd arrived at the safe house after Hermione had activated the charm multiple times in a row. He hadn't known where she was headed, a flaw he hadn't realised until just now, but he knew the mission envelope was likely at the safe house. Hermione wasn't stupid and at the very least, she would have left her location available to him.

After finding the envelope and skimming for the location, he cursed again and apparated away. He didn't bother distancing himself from the building as he knew he didn't have time to walk, so with his hood pulled over his face and an illusion charm only Hermione would see through, he stormed into the building and fired curses at anything that moved. When he came across a very injured werewolf, Draco smiled. He'd seen how powerful Hermione was before, but this only further proved it.

"Where the fuck is she?" he sneered, leveling his wand at the wolf. The werewolf just growled and sneered back, so Draco hit him with a crucio curse that had him writhing for several seconds. As impatient as he was, however, he released the werewolf and demanded, "Tell me where she went."

The werewolf just snickered and as he raised his head to howl, Draco cut his head from his shoulders and continued through the building.

He very quickly realised he was never going to find Hermione if he kept going like this and as the charm against his chest heated up two more times, he became increasingly worried. Just as he was beginning to wonder how he'd be able to find her, he remembered a spell she'd crafted and showed him a week ago. It was fairly complicated, but Draco had used it a few times and felt confident enough he could figure it out. He took several long seconds to focus his thoughts on Hermione before casting the tracking charm.

As he opened his eyes, he could see a faint trail taking him down the hall. He sprinted after it, casting curses at anyone he came across and hardly stumbling over a pile of bodies. When the trail stopped on the other side of the door, Draco threw up a shield before shouldering through the door and into the room.

At the center of of the room, Hermione was getting swallowed by Death Eaters and numerous dark creatures. Many of them were injured, but that wasn't stopping them from continuing their attack on Hermione. Draco arrived just in time to hear one of them yell crucio at the same time someone else used sectumsempra. Hermione screamed.

Draco didn't think as he cut off the heads of the creatures closest to him. He cut down the next row of Death Eaters as Hermione continued to scream louder than he could have ever imagined. By the time those farthest from him turned to attack him, he was firing fatal curses faster than they could blink. He crucio'd the wizard who still had the crucio curse trained on Hermione and he passed out. The Death Eater that had used sectumsempra found himself speared to the wall with several small knives and in one motion, he sent blades through the hearts of every Death Eater and werewolf that was still standing.

Breathing heavily, he looked around the room to ensure they were all dead. Just to be sure, he sent bullets through every body he saw before dropping down beside Hermione. There was a long, jagged cut from her shoulder blade that wrapped around her back and almost to her belly button. Draco murmured a sealing charm that would stop her bleeding and carefully gathered her in his arms. Before anyone else could come, he apparated them back to the safe house and put up several new wards for safe keeping.

"Took you long enough," Hermione groaned, inhaling sharply as he set her on the sofa.

Draco rolled his eyes and vanished her robes so he could see the cut better. It was hard to look at and Draco had to glance away for a moment.

"What? Never seen a mostly naked girl before?" Hermione teased. Her voice was breathier than Draco cared to admit, but he still shook his head with a small smile.

"This is going to leave a nasty scar," Draco said, grabbing a tighter hold of his wand.

"It better considering how painful it is," Hermione replied. Draco rolled his eyes and shifted so he could easily reach Hermione's back.

"Well, it's about to hurt worse," Draco muttered before slowly starting down the cut with a mending spell.

Hermione gasped at the sharp pain and her hand landed on Draco's knee. He kept his wand steady despite Hermione's heavy breathing and the tight grip she had on his knee. When he was finally finished stitching up the large wound, she let go of his knee and reached around to run her fingers over the scar.

"Thanks," she said. She summoned her robes then cleaned and mended them. Once they were back to normal, she slipped them on so she was wearing more than just her bra and panties then looked at Draco. "I was told there'd only be a dozen or so Death Eaters meeting with a pair of werewolves, nothing big. It was supposed to be easy to infiltrate and bomb, but I got caught."

"We need a better system," Draco told her. He told her how he'd had to come to the safe house to find out where she was and that there had to be a some other way for him to know. "Could you put a tracker on the charms?"

Hermione scowled.

"So you can find me anytime of day and bug me?" she asked. Draco rolled his eyes, but she was already unclasping her necklace and reaching for his.

He waited patiently as she muttered a series of spells then handed his necklace back to him. As soon as the charm touched his skin, it heated up, glowing faintly, then faded back to normal. Draco looked up just in time to see Hermione's charm fade back as well. Catching his eye, she smirked.

"It's attuned to your magic now," she explained. Even if the charm wasn't on him, she could still trace him via his magic and vice versa.

"Sounds like a tracker," he teased.

Hermione snorted and stood up from the couch. Draco ignored the way her hands shook slightly as an after effect from the cruciatus curse.

"Try not to die next time, eh, Granger?" he said, catching her attention before she could apparate away. "We're supposed to be partners and I'd hate for someone like Weasel to be my new contact."

Hermione snorted again, covering her mouth a second too late. Draco caught just a glimpse of a smile before she was rolling her eyes at him and promising to try her best. With a wink, she disappeared right in front of him and Draco was left alone in the safe house.
